Breece Hall Trade Rumors Heat Up as Jets Consider Move Ahead of NFL Deadline

As the NFL trade deadline approaches, speculation is growing around the New York Jets possibly trading running back Breece Hall. This comes amid a new coaching regime, with head coach Aaron Glenn expressing a preference for a committee approach in the backfield. Despite Glenn addressing Hall directly to dispel rumors earlier this offseason, the talks about a potential move have not subsided.

Coaching Staff’s Confidence in Backup Running Backs

According to NFL insider Tony Pauline from Sportskeeda, sources close to the Jets indicate that the team could part ways with Hall in favor of promoting RB Braelon Allen as the starter and RB Isaiah Davis as his backup. The coaching staff has reportedly been impressed with the performance of both backs, which may influence their decision to trade Hall before the deadline.

Breece Hall’s Background and Recent Performance

Breece Hall, 24, had a distinguished college career at Iowa State, where he was a two-time All-American and twice named Big 12 player of the year. The Jets selected him early in the second round, with the 36th overall pick in the 2022 NFL Draft. Hall signed a four-year deal worth just over $9 million, which includes a $3.7 million signing bonus. His contract runs through 2025, after which he will be an unrestricted free agent in 2026.

During the 2024 season, Hall played in 16 games, carrying the ball 209 times for 876 yards, averaging 4.2 yards per carry, and scoring five rushing touchdowns. He also contributed in the passing game, catching 57 passes on 76 targets for 483 yards and three touchdowns, demonstrating his dual-threat capability as a running back.

What This Could Mean for the Jets Moving Forward

If the Jets decide to trade Hall, the move would signify a strategic shift toward developing younger talent in Allen and Davis. This approach aligns with the coaching staff’s vision of a running back committee, potentially offering more versatility in their offensive schemes. The trade deadline decision will be crucial in shaping the Jets’ roster and offensive identity for the remainder of the season.
